Sanctuary wrote: ...I wonder if he can then erect a solid fence around the quoit (being his land) just leaving an entrance for the public to enter? It would preserve the monument from the horses but be pretty dull to look at wouldn't it.
A six foot exclusion zone really isn’t big enough is it, and a fence around an area that small would be an eyesore. The exclusion zone would need to be increased to what? 50 foot? before a fence at that distance no longer impinged visually on the monument. Wouldn’t need to be a fence either, a hawthorn hedge with a gate in it would do the trick. Have a grassed area between the quoit and the hedge, a couple of benches there maybe, and suddenly it’s a place of wonder and respect for the monument (and the people who made it) instead of the muck and chaos that surrounds it now.
Just a vision, a little money and the will to make it happen...
